“Tequila: Helping people wake up in strangers’ beds since 1521”

"Tequila: Helping people wake up in strangers’ beds since 1521” is a jocular saying that has been printed on many images.

“Tequila! Helping people wake up in stranger’s beds since 1521!” was posted on Twitter by Chichi Igwe™ on September 16, 2015. “Tequila. Helping people wake up in stranger’s beds since 1521” was posted on Twitter by Aalok Gautam 🥰 on September 26, 2015. “Tequila. Helping people wake up in stranger’s beds since 1521” was posted on Twitter by K Tate on September 28, 2015. The saying probably originated on an image.

“Beer: Helping ugly people get laid since 1862,” “Beer: Helping white people dance since 1837” and “Bourbon: Making ice taste better since 1783” are similar sayings.
